Transaction efdc79e8391743db89cb6b695da1effa35fd1fea752f47cda0c6a030c5723110

1 Input
2 Outputs
  • efdc79e8391743db89cb6b695da1effa35fd1fea752f47cda0c6a030c5723110:0
  • value  25030000
    address  17fkgA2jeNyjPzNdR9WiM5cDiKBkt6X3Fx
  • efdc79e8391743db89cb6b695da1effa35fd1fea752f47cda0c6a030c5723110:1
  • value  916971033
    address  3FFH8eM5qqRTMNs543xSY9LyVStY5d3ouH